Optimization of the fastening system of the truck using MEMS accelerometers

This paper concerns the possibility of MEMS accelerometers employment in road transportation assessment. It makes use of statistical analysis tools and calculation of securing forces for the sake of road safety enhancement. The transport experiment was carried out and the statistical analysis shows a possible solution to the assessment of shocks during transportation, that in general adversely affect the cargo being transported (cargo securing), the vehicle, the driver, etc. From the results, it follows that even in the case of a high quality road (highway), the values of the shocks at higher speeds considerably exceed the expected magnitudes as defined in the respective standards. The assessment of truck transportation with up-to-date MEMS accelerometers is simple and relatively inexpensive and may represent a considerable contribution to road safety, including associated financial benefits.
